• 31-01-2010, 17:04:30
    #1
    Merhaba,

    Sitemde bir sıralama sorunu var,bu konuda yardım rica ediyorum.

    Resimde gördüğünüz gibi, menü, sidebarın bittiği yerde başlıyor. Yeşil anaüstün hemen altından devam etmesi gerekirken.




    HTML

    <div id="govde">
    <div id="sidebar"> text </div>
    <div id="anabolum">
    <div id="anaust"> text </div> <div style="clear:both;"></div> <div id="menu"> <div style="clear:both;"></div> </div>
    </div>
    </div>
    CSS

    #govde {
        width:%100;
        }
    
    #anabolum {
        width:700px;
        margin-right:10px;
        }
    
    #sidebar {
        width:265px;
        margin:0px;
        float:right;
        padding: 0px 0px 10px 0px;
        display: inline;
        }
    
    #anaust {
        display:inline;
        height:300px;
        width:%100;
        }
    
    
    #menu{
    width: 697px;
    margin: 20px auto;
    display:inline;
    }
  • 31-01-2010, 18:17:39
    #2
    Kimlik doğrulama veya yönetimden onay bekliyor.
    şöyle yapın

    <div class="cerceve">
    <div class="ortasol">
    <div class="anaust"></div>
    <div class="menu"></div>
    </div>

    <div class="sidebar"></div>
    </div>

    ortasol classına float:left deyince olur.
  • 31-01-2010, 18:23:59
    #3
    AycanB adlı üyeden alıntı: mesajı görüntüle
    şöyle yapın

    <div class="cerceve">
    <div class="ortasol">
    <div class="anaust"></div>
    <div class="menu"></div>
    </div>

    <div class="sidebar"></div>
    </div>

    ortasol classına float:left deyince olur.
    Olmadı malesef.
  • 31-01-2010, 18:54:30
    #4
    <div id="anabolum">

    <div id="anaust"> textsdsadsd </div><br>
    <div id="menu">asdasdsadasdsdsd</div> <div style="clear:both;"></div>
    </div>

    Valla senin kod bu şekilde çalışır ama..Bana sorarsan böyle mi yapardın diye böyle yapmazdım... Baskasının yazdıklarını anlamak gerecekten güç
  • 31-01-2010, 18:57:49
    #5
    ugur_ben adlı üyeden alıntı: mesajı görüntüle
    <div id="anabolum">

    <div id="anaust"> textsdsadsd </div><br>
    <div id="menu">asdasdsadasdsdsd</div> <div style="clear:both;"></div>
    </div>

    Valla senin kod bu şekilde çalışır ama..Bana sorarsan böyle mi yapardın diye böyle yapmazdım... Baskasının yazdıklarını anlamak gerecekten güç
    Menu'den önce eklenmiş clear'ı kaldırmamı öneriyorsunuz sanırım. Bunu kaldırınca menünün görünümü bozuluyor, kaldıramam o yüzden malesef
  • 31-01-2010, 19:13:26
    #6
    Üyeliği durduruldu
    Kemal bi örnek hazırladım incele istersen.

    Ayrıca width:%100; diye bir değer yoktur, width:100%; olması gerekli.
  • 31-01-2010, 22:12:56
    #7
    KMLGRLR adlı üyeden alıntı: mesajı görüntüle
    Olmadı malesef.
    bunun olamamsı imkamsız birbirinden bağımsız class'lar divler tanımladık css dosyanda bi problem var gerek css resetlerken gerekte div taglarında.
  • 31-01-2010, 22:39:23
    #8
    Üyeliği durduruldu
    AycanB adlı üyeden alıntı: mesajı görüntüle
    bunun olamamsı imkamsız birbirinden bağımsız class'lar divler tanımladık css dosyanda bi problem var gerek css resetlerken gerekte div taglarında.
    Problem Kemal'in bağsettiğinden daha büyük , çok fazla yanlış ve karmaşık bi kodlama vardı çözüldü neyseki.